JOHN THOMAS BARNARD

Sunday, December 20, 1953
Elizabeth City, North Carolina, December 19 - Age 62, of 716
Second Street, died Friday, December 18, 1953 in De Paul Hospital
in Norfolk. Funeral services will be conducted at the Toxey,
Berry and Lynch Funeral Home Sunday, December 20, 1953 at 3:00
pm. Burial will follow in the family cemetery in Camden County.
He was a native of Camden and the son of ISAAC BARNARD and ALICE
HAYMAN BARNARD and the husband of LILLIE CARTWRIGHT BARNARD. He
had been living in Elizabeth City for a number of years.
Surviving are 2 daughters, Mrs. ROYCE TARKINGTON of Norfolk and
Mrs. CLIFTON TRUEBLOOD of Elizabeth City, Route 4; 2 sons,
RAYMOND BARNARD of Elizabeth City and JOHN M. BARNARD of Sanford;
3 sisters, Mrs. MOLLIE CARTWRIGHT of Camden and Mrs. JACK JORDAN
and Mrs. JODIE BELL, both of Elizabeth City; 2 brothers, GRANDY
B. BARNARD of Shiloh and MACK BARNARD of Norfolk and 9
grandchildren.
